一、引言

随着信息技术的飞速发展,大数据成为了现代社会重要的生产要素之一。然而,虽然大数据带来了巨大的经济效益和社会价值,但其面临的数据隐私、数据安全以及数据孤岛等问题也愈发明显。区块链技术,作为一种去中心化的分布式账本技术,为解决大数据所面临的各种问题提供了新的思路和方案。本文将详细探讨区块链与大数据结合所构建的新一代数据平台及其潜力。

二、区块链基础知识概述

区块链与大数据:构建新一代数据平台的未来

在深入讨论之前,首先需要理解区块链的基本概念。区块链是一种记录交易的数字账本,其特点包括去中心化、不可篡改和透明性。每一个区块包含了一系列交易记录,而这些区块通过密码学链接在一起,形成一个持续增长的账本链。

区块链技术的本质在于去中心化,意味着数据不再存储在单一位置,而是分布在网络中的多个节点上。这使得数据在被篡改的情况下难以被修改,因为所有节点都需要达到一致的共识才能进行更改。

三、大数据的挑战与痛点

大数据的价值在于其分析能力、处理能力以及决策支持能力。然而,随着数据量的不断增加,多个行业在应用大数据时常常面临诸多挑战:

1. 数据隐私与安全性
由于数据的敏感性,如何在确保用户隐私的前提下利用数据进行分析是一大挑战。在数据泄露事件频频发生的背景下,企业亟需找到安全可靠的数据管理方案。

2. 数据孤岛
在企业内部,往往存在多个数据库,这导致信息难以共享,形成所谓的数据孤岛。不同部门、行业之间的数据无法有效整合,限制了数据的价值体现。

3. 数据真实性
在信息流通的过程中,如何确保数据的真实性和准确性是另一个重要问题。如果数据的来源不可靠,那么基于这些数据得出的结论也将存在问题。

四、区块链解决大数据问题的潜力

区块链与大数据:构建新一代数据平台的未来

结合区块链技术,大数据平台能够在以下几个方面实现突破:

1. 数据安全与隐私保护
区块链的加密性质使得数据在传输和存储过程中更加安全。用户可以通过加密技术有效地保护个人隐私,且数据一旦写入区块链便无法篡改,为数据的真实性提供了保障。

2. 数据共享与互通性
区块链能够促进不同组织间的数据共享,消除数据孤岛。通过共识机制,不同节点可以对数据进行实时更新和修改,从而实现各方的互信与合作。

3. 提高数据追溯能力
在区块链上,数据记录的每一次变更都会被记录下来,这意味着可以轻松追溯到数据的来源及其变化过程。这有助于提高数据的透明度,同时也为合规管理提供了支持。

五、构建区块链大数据平台的关键要素

在实际应用中,构建一个有效的区块链大数据平台需要多方面的考虑:

1. 合适的区块链架构
根据不同的应用场景,可以选择公有链、私有链或联盟链。不同的架构对速度、隐私性和安全性等方面有不同的影响,需根据需求做出选择。

2. 数据治理机制
为了确保数据的质量和管理效率,必须建立健全的数据治理机制,包括数据标准化、数据分类与分级、数据访问权限管理等。

3. 技术堆栈
在技术实施层面,需要选择合适的技术栈来支持区块链和大数据的结合,如分布式数据库、智能合约等。

六、相关问题探讨

在深入讨论区块链大数据平台的过程中,以下五个问题值得深入探究:

区块链如何提高数据共享的效率?

区块链是一种分布式数据存储技术,建立在去中心化的基础上,任何参与节点都可以访问和验证区块链网络中的数据。这不仅能消除数据孤岛,还可以提升数据共享的效率。

传统的数据共享方式往往依赖于中心化数据库,这会导致信息传递滞后、权限管理复杂等问题。而在区块链中,每个节点在获得数据后可以直接进行验证,减少了中介环节。这种机制使得数据的共享和流通变得更加高效、迅速。

另外,利用智能合约,区块链还可以自动执行数据共享条件,这意味着数据的共享流程能够被程序化,从而进一步提升效率。通过定义数据访问的规则和条件,相关方可以更快速地共享数据,减少了人工干预的必要性。

最后,在区块链上,所有的数据共享行为都有明确的时间戳和记录,这为数据的可信性提供了保障。这就使得所有参与者对于共享的数据有了共同的信任基础,从而降低信任成本。开放而透明的数据共享环境将极大促进各方的合作与共赢,形成良性的生态圈。

区块链如何保障数据的安全性?

随着网络攻击和数据盗窃行为的频繁发生,数据安全问题受到越来越多的关注。区块链技术的引入为解决数据安全问题提供了新的视角。首先,区块链采用的密码学技术为数据提供了强有力的保障。每个交易记录通过加密算法生成哈希值,它不仅确保了数据在传输过程中的安全性,也使得任何对数据的篡改都可以被及时检测。

其次,区块链的去中心化特性使得数据不再依赖于单一的中心化服务器。当数据分布在全球的多个节点上时,即使某个节点遭到攻击,其他节点仍可以保持数据的完整性和可用性。这种冗余特性使得系统对攻击的抵御能力大大增强。

此外,采用联盟链或私有链的方式也可以有效地提升数据的安全性。在这些场景中,由于参与者是经过严格筛选和验证的,因此相对而言数据的安全性和隐私性能够得到更好地保护。各方可以通过合约约定如何使用和分享数据,提高了数据的使用安全。

区块链如何实现数据的有效追溯?

数据追溯是大数据管理中一个重要的环节,能够帮助企业了解数据的来源及其变化过程,进而提高数据的可信性。区块链的不可篡改性和透明性使得数据追溯变得非常简单。所有在区块链上记录的交易都会被永久保留,每一次数据的更新、修改都会生成一个新的记录,并且原始数据也会被保存。

通过这种方式,企业可以随时检查某一数据的整个生命周期,从而验证其真实性。例如,在供应链管理领域,企业能够追踪某一原材料的来源、运输路径及其存储过程,这对于库存管理、质量控制等环节都至关重要。

同时,区块链上的每个数据记录都具有时间戳信息,能够清晰地展示数据在不同时间点的状态。通过结合数据分析技术,企业可以进一步洞察数据变化的模式,而这对于预测未来的趋势、进行风险控制都提供了强有力的支持。

关键在于,数据追溯不仅能帮助企业内部管理,还能提升与外部合作方的信任。例如在食品安全领域,消费者可以通过扫描产品上的区块链识别码,实时获取关于产品来源和运输过程的信息,极大提高了消费者对品牌的信任度。

如何设计可扩展的区块链大数据平台?

构建可扩展的区块链大数据平台是一项复杂的工程,必须综合考虑技术架构、数据治理、网络性能等多个方面。首先,选择适合的区块链架构至关重要。公有链适合交易透明性要求高的场景,而联盟链则适合需要参与者间互信的情境。每种架构在性能上都有其优势与劣势,需根据具体应用场景进行选择。

其次,数据的治理和管理机制必须简单有效。数据标准化是提升数据质量的关键,所有参与者需要遵循统一的数据格式和标准,这样才能在整个平台上实现高效的数据交换。此外,要设计合理的数据访问权限管理,确保各参与方在允许的范围内使用数据,同时又不泄露敏感信息。

网络性能也值得重视,区块链的扩展性在很大程度上取决于其共识机制的设计。例如,采用分层设计的共识机制,可以将计算复杂度较高的事务处理分摊到不同的层面,实现更高的交易吞吐量。此外,可以利用链下处理技术,将高频交易或计算密集型的任务转移到链下,提升整体性能。

最后,还应关注平台的持续更新与用户反馈。在实际应用中,要不断平台的性能和用户体验,定期收集用户的意见和建议,对系统进行改进。通过迭代更新,构建出一个更具适应性和灵活性的区块链大数据平台。

区块链在大数据应用中的未来展望是什么?

随着区块链和大数据领域的不断发展,两者的结合将会为各行业带来深远的影响。首先,区块链将帮助企业更好地管理数据,提高更多业务场景的透明度和信任度。未来,随着技术的成熟,更多行业将逐步采用这一技术实现数据的合理利用与共享。

其次,随着行业标准和政策法规的逐步建立,区块链在数据治理方面的应用将更加广泛。各企业之间也将形成更加稳固的合作关系,开放共享的数据生态将得到推广,促进资源的有效配置。

此外,结合人工智能与区块链技术的趋势愈发明显。通过人工智能算法的辅助,区块链提供的数据可用于更复杂的决策支持和自动化处理,为未来的数字经济发展提供新的可能性。

最后,用户教育也将成为重要的内容。企业和用户之间需要充分交流,了解彼此的需求与担忧,确保区块链和大数据的实现更符合实际需求,从而推动市场的整体发展。

结论

区块链与大数据的结合为企业提供了一个新机遇,通过去中心化、安全可靠的数据管理与共享方案,解决了传统大数据面临的诸多挑战。不仅能够提升数据的安全性与可信性,还能促进数据的有效追溯与共享,为各行业的数字化转型提供支持。

随着区块链技术的不断进步,大数据应用的前景将越来越广泛。我们正站在一个新的技术革命的起点,期待在未来能够实现更大的价值创造和社会效益。